Importance of AutoCAD and Creo in Mechanical Design

Two of the most potent software tools a Design Engineer can wield are AutoCAD and Creo. Each serves unique purposes and offers different features that are crucial for various aspects of mechanical design.

AutoCAD

AutoCAD is a versatile software used for creating 2D and 3D designs. Known for its efficiency and precision, it is widely used for drafting and blueprinting in industries such as architecture, engineering, and construction. The key benefits include:

  • Comprehensive drafting tools that expedite the design process.
  • Ability to work with geometrically accurate 2D and 3D models.
  • Support for collaborative work environments through cloud storage and shared access.

Creo

Creo, developed by PTC, is a potent tool for 3D CAD modeling, often favored in the mechanical engineering sector. It is known for its advanced capabilities, such as parametric design and robust simulation features. The key advantages of using Creo include:

  • Parametric design for maintaining design intent across various model iterations.
  • Simulation and testing capabilities for virtual environment analysis.
  • Integration with internet of things (IoT) applications, providing a futuristic edge.

Steps to Advance Your Career as a Design Engineer

To progress your career as a Design Engineer armed with AutoCAD and Creo skills, you need a strategic approach.

Enhance Your Technical Skills

  1. Gear Up with Certifications: Obtain certifications in AutoCAD and Creo to formalize your expertise. These certificates not only enhance your resume but also prove your competency in these tools.
  2. Continuous Learning: Stay abreast of the latest updates and features in AutoCAD and Creo. Engage in online courses, webinars, and workshops regularly.

Develop a Robust Portfolio

Your portfolio is a testament to your skills and creativity. Ensure it includes a variety of projects that highlight your capability to use AutoCAD and Creo effectively, alongside comprehensive design reports and blueprints.

Network within the Industry

Networking can significantly impact your career trajectory. Attend industry conferences, join professional organizations such as ASME (American Society of Mechanical Engineers), and engage with communities focused on AutoCAD and Creo.

Seek Mentorship

A mentor can provide invaluable advice and guidance. Seek out seasoned professionals who have successfully navigated the career path you aspire to follow.

Opportunities for Growth in Design Engineering

Design Engineering offers diverse growth opportunities, contingent upon your skills and strategic efforts.

Senior Design Engineer

With experience and a strong portfolio, progression to senior roles is achievable. As a Senior Design Engineer, you will lead project teams and drive design innovations.

Product Manager

Leveraging your design experience, you could transition into a Product Manager role, where you'll be responsible for overseeing the development cycle, from concept to market launch.

Research and Development

If innovation fascinates you, exploring roles in R&D can be rewarding. Here you'll be at the forefront of technological advancements, designing cutting-edge products.
